Labrador Retriever

Image Credit: © Greta Hoffman / Pexels

Labrador Retrievers feel instantly familiar because they seem to smile with their whole face. Broad heads, otter tails, and that athletic, water loving build make them pop in any crowd.

You picture one fetching a tennis ball, then flopping beside your feet like a lifelong buddy.

They are gentle with kids yet ready for adventure, which is why you see them in ads, movies, and family photos. Labs also work as guide dogs and search partners, so even non dog people recognize their purposeful calm.

Give them a job, a lake, and snacks, and you have a legend. Keep training light and consistent, and they will return joy with tireless fetch sessions and muddy, happy paws.

German Shepherd

Image Credit: © Ruben Boekeloo / Pexels

German Shepherds carry authority in every line, from the proud head to the solid, athletic frame. That black and tan saddle pattern and upright ears are a near universal silhouette.

You picture police work, movie heroes, and a guardian who reads the room before you even speak.

They balance courage with sensitivity, which is why they star in service roles around the world. Even people who barely know breeds recognize the purposeful trot and steady eye contact.

With training, they become focused teammates that thrive on meaningful tasks. Provide mental workouts, not just walks, and you unlock their brilliance.

The look is unmistakable, the reputation legendary, and the presence feels like confidence you can lean on.

Corgi

Image Credit: © Pexels / Pexels

Corgis are low riding charm machines, long backed with big ears and a famously photogenic backside. The grin, the prance, and the foxlike face turn routine walks into parades.

You imagine royalty, memes, and a tiny herder determined to manage your living room.

Pembrokes usually have docked tails while Cardigans keep a long one, but both announce themselves with confidence. They need brain work as much as play, or they will outsmart your schedule.

Keep sessions short, varied, and fun, and you will get sharp responses wrapped in cuteness. Regular exercise avoids couch sprint zoomies.

Even dog novices spot a Corgi instantly, because short legs plus big personality is an unforgettable picture.
